Refacing is a refreshing choice

Unlike a complete remodel, refacing preserves your existing cabinet framework. Instead of tearing the whole thing down the real magic is updating the doors, drawers and even the hardware. This option has a number of advantages:

An efficient and cost-effective change is essential to any remodeling project. Refacing can be a much less expensive option than the entire remodeling. It allows you to get a beautiful update without having to break the bank.

Refacing your cabinets is a sustainable option. When you use the cabinet’s original structure to reface and reduce the amount of construction waste. This environmentally friendly solution minimizes the environmental impact and allows you breathe new life into an already functional system.

Refacing your kitchen is simple and quick compared to a remodel. This means less disruption to your everyday routine and lets you enjoy your newly refreshed kitchen sooner.

Unlocking Your Style: Refacing Options and Ideas

Doors and drawers The material you choose for your doors and drawers set the mood for your kitchen. The timeless elegance of wood is enhanced by the wide range of colors and textures offered in laminate. If you want to give a hint of class, opt for acrylic or glass.

Hardware Revolution: The ideal hardware can completely transform your kitchen’s look. Explore a variety of options, from sleek and modern knobs to traditional pulls.

The power of Paint: Refacing doesn’t need to be limited to new doors and drawers. A fresh coat of painted cabinets can completely change your kitchen’s design and style. Choose bold pops or neutrals for a visual flow.

Inspiration is Waiting for You: From Classical to Contemporary

Are you struggling to find your way in the world of design? Let’s look at some alternatives to refacing:

Modern Makeover: Replace the old wood cabinet doors with sleek flat-panel laminate in bold white or black colors. For a modern and sleek design, pair the style with simple hardware.

Timeless Classic: Decorate your cabinets with rich wood-grain doors, adorned with traditional brushed nickel hardware to bring out the beauty and warmth of wood in its natural form. Add glass inserts to upper cabinets for a touch of elegance.

A Touch of Farmhouse Charm Give your home a cozy farmhouse style by replacing your cabinets with stained or distressed doors made of wood. Opt for hardware that is rustic and consider painting the existing cabinets’ frames white for the perfect contrast.

Budget-conscious Tips for a Kitchen Refresh

There are a variety of ways to make your budget stretch further.

DIY or Hire a Professional? : While some may be adept enough to tackle smaller refitting projects on their own using a professional, hiring a pro guarantees a perfect job and eliminates costly mistakes.

Compare prices: Compare the prices of different manufacturers of doors, drawers, and hardware.

Focus on High-Impact Changes Make sure to replace only the most noticeable cabinet components, like doors and drawer fronts and update the remaining areas by applying a fresh coat of paint.
